Iowa State ranked No. 13 in latest AP Poll

Iowa State men’s basketball dropped a spot to No. 13 in the latest AP Poll release, following a 1-1 week that included Saturday’s loss to Missouri.

The Tigers moved to the first spot in the ‘others receiving votes’ category and Kansas State dropped to No. 7 after losing to the Cyclones Tuesday.

Iowa State takes on Texas Tech Monday night (8:00 p.m. ESPN2) before squaring up with No. 8 Kansas on Saturday at Hilton Coliseum.
